Tema: Agrupamiento
Ver Mensaje Individual
  #2 (permalink)  
Antiguo 08/07/2005, 03:45
Avatar de Vice
Vice
 
Fecha de Ingreso: agosto-2003
Mensajes: 613
Antigüedad: 21 años, 7 meses
Puntos: 2
Escueto:
select count(*) total from tabla -> te da el total de filas. Ya de ir a leerla, pues que te cuente ella misma :P
select tv,count(*) totaltv from tabla group by tv -> te da el total para cada tv, si quieres sólo de una tv en concreto, pued añade la condición "tv=$tv"
Para mostrar los datos, pues un while donde para cada televisión:
totaltv*100/total
Si solo miras los datos de una tv, pues no hace falta el while.
(%, tanto en mysql como en php, es un operador para el cálculo del resto)

Espero que te ayude.
Un saludo.
__________________
Estoy contagiado de Generación-I